Arianwen (Welsh) comes from Welsh arian, from Middle Welsh ariant, from Proto-Brythonic arɣant, from Proto-Celtic argantom, from Proto-Indo-European h₂r̥ǵn̥tóm, from Proto-Indo-European h₂erǵ- — white, argent; glittering.
